云南省思茅区思茅松蓄积量与植被指数关系研究

         

摘要

以普洱市思茅区2005年森林资源规划设计调查 (二类调查) 数据为基础,基于Landsat TM遥感影像,开展对普洱市思茅区思茅松蓄积量与各类植被指数的定量研究.结果表明:当郁闭度为29%~40%时,蓄积量与环境植被指数EVI的拟合效果最好,相关性最强,拟合优度指数R2=0.42;郁闭度为40%~70%时,蓄积量与归一化植被指数NDVI的拟合优度最好,相关性最强,拟合优度指数R2=0.561;郁闭度大于70%时,蓄积量与RVI的拟合优度最好,相关性最强,拟合优度指数R2=0.568.坡向对蓄积量与植被指数的关系条件要求不严格,在估测蓄积量的时候可以忽略坡向的影响权重.就蓄积量与植被指数拟合模型的效果来看,三次多项式拟合模型效果最佳,较适用于蓄积量与植被指数关系的定量研究.%Based on the data of the second class investigation of the 2005 Planning and Desining of Forest Resources in Simao District, Puer City and the Landsat TM RS Image, this study carries out the quantitative research of the stocking volume of Pinus Khasys and all kinds of vegetation index in Simao District, Puer City.The results of the research have shown that the stocking volume and the invironmental vegetation index yield the best fitting effects with the strongest correlation of R2=0.42 when the crown density is 29%-40%;the stocking volume and the normalized differential vegetation index (NDVI) yield the best fitting effects with the strongest correlation of R2=0.561 when the crown density is 40%-70%;the stocking volume and the RVI yield the best fitting effects with the strongest correlation of R2=0.568 when the crown density is above 70%.The relationship between the aspect and the stocking volume as well as the vegetation index is not strict, and the influential weightings of the aspect can be ignored when estimating the stocking volume.From the perspective of the effects of the fitting model on the stocking volume and vegetation index, the cubic polynomial fitting model yields the best effects, and it is suitable for the quantitative research of the relation between the stocking volume and the vegetation index.
